Figure 1 Key members of the Work Group that developed the first Kidney Disease Outcomes Quality Initiative (KDOQI) clinical practice guideline, evaluation, classification, and stratification of chronic kidney disease.29 Standing from left to right are Andrew S. Levey, MD, Chair of the Work Group; Cynda Ann Johnson, MD, MBA, member of the Work Group; Garabed Eknoyan, MD, co-chair of KDOQI; and Josef Coresh, MD, PhD, Vice-Chair of the Work Group.
